What will happen?

Over the course of about five and a half hours, the Moon will first enter the diffuse outer portion of our planet's shadow, then spend about three hours and twenty minutes crossing the darker, red-tinged umbra, until it passes out into the other side of the penumbra, growing brighter until it exits the shadow altogether.

For roughly an hour at the start, the Moon will darken, almost imperceptively. This darkening will become more obvious between 60-90 minutes after the start, as the Moon closes in on the edge of the umbra. Then, it will increase dramatically as the eastern limb of the Moon (the left side) slips into the umbra.

From there, once the Moon starts its journey across the umbra, it will take about one hour and 45 minutes for the eclipse to reach its maximum.

Since the alignment of the Sun, Earth, and Moon aren't perfect this time around, the Moon will be roughly 93 per cent immersed in the umbra at maximum, making this a partial lunar eclipse.

During the first 90 minutes or so of this umbral journey, the shadow will simply creep across the Moon's face, making it appear as though it is being swallowed by darkness.

Now, the umbral core of Earth's shadow is tinged a dusky red colour, due to the combination of the light from all of the sunrises and sunsets around the world being focused by the atmosphere into that portion of the shadow.

When there is a total lunar eclipse, this red colour becomes obvious once the Moon is completely immersed in the umbra.

However, due to the way the human eye perceives light and colour, it is difficult to notice that redness during the partial phase of the eclipse. The portion of the Moon still in the penumbra can be bright enough to overwhelm our sense of colour, making the rest of the Moon's surface appear simply black as a result.

So, with this being a partial eclipse at maximum, it will be a challenge to notice the colour. Using a camera will help, as the settings can dial down the contrast. To the unaided eye, though, we may only perceive the red for a short period of time, just before and after the eclipse maximum.

Following the eclipse maximum, it will take another 90 minutes for the Moon to completely exit the umbra, and then a little over an hour more for the eclipse to end.

The Timing

Everyone across Canada with reasonably clear skies should be able to see most of this eclipse, including the maximum partial eclipse, when the Moon will be around 93 per cent immersed into the darkest part of Earth's shadow.

However, for locations farther west, the eclipse will begin earlier in the evening. Thus, for some observers, the eclipse will have already begun by the time the Moon rises.

In Saskatchewan and Alberta, the Moon will rise during the 'penumbral' phase of the eclipse.

For observers in British Columbia, the Moon will already have started its journey across the darker umbra by the time it crests the horizon.

Best until the end of 2028

Lunar eclipses occur, on average, once every six months. Now, 2027 and 2028 are somewhat unusual, in that we'll actually see three lunar eclipses throughout each of those years — in February, July, and August of 2027, and then January, June, and December of 2028.

However, all three of the 2027 eclipses will be only penumbral, with the Moon passing through the outer portion of Earth's shadow and completely missing the darker inner umbra.

Plus, in 2028, the first two eclipses will be partial. During the January one, less than 10 per cent of the Moon's edge will pass through the edge of the umbra, while only around 40 per cent of the Moon's disk will be immersed in the umbra for the June one.

We have to wait until December 31, 2028, before the next total lunar eclipse appears, although that one will only be visible at moonset from the western half of Canada. The eastern half of the country is favoured with the total lunar eclipse that follows after, which occurs on June 26, 2029.
